Corail fossilisé agatisé – le motif floral de la nature
Despite its name, chrysanthemum stone does not contain fossilized flowers. Its distinctive patterns come from ancient coral structures that gradually transformed into stone over millions of years.
During this natural process, the coral’s original structure was slowly replaced by silica, preserving intricate shapes that resemble tiny chrysanthemums, stars and blossoms. Every bead is naturally different, with its own pattern and combination of cream, beige, brown and grey tones.
This makes each bracelet a small piece of natural history — shaped by time and impossible to reproduce exactly.
